I had an amazing Christmas. I got all kinds of good clothes including pj pants, running clothes/shoes, some nice underwear and socks, and a few other goodies. I got a Garmin 405 forerunner. It a nice GPS watch with a HR monitor. I've worn it on almost all of my runs since Christmas. It shows: time, distance, pace, avg. HR, calories burned, and elevation. And the info uploads on my computer automatically when the watch is within 3 meters of my computer, I don't even have to hook it up. It's fun to play with.
